What do we mean when we speak of diversity at the Foothill-De Anza Community College District? The Human Resources &amp;amp; Equal Opportunity Office offers one definition:</description>
			</item>
		<item>
			<description>&lt;em&gt;&quot;Diversity refers to human qualities that are different from our own and those of groups to which we belong; but that are manifested in other individuals and groups. Dimensions of diversity include but are not limited to: age, ethnicity, gender, physical abilities / qualities, race, sexual orientation, educational background, geographic location, income, marital status, military experience, parental status, religious beliefs, work experience, and job classification.&quot; &lt;/em&gt;</description>
			</item>
		<item>
			<description>Diversity as a concept focuses on a broader set of qualities than race and gender. In the context of the workplace, valuing diversity means creating a workplace that respects and includes differences, recognizing the unique contributions that individuals with many types of differences can make, and creating a work environment that maximizes the potential of all employees.</description>
			</item>
		<item>
			<description>Diversity is also about having the long term goal that the campus work force should generally reflect the population of the state it serves in all its dimensions.</description>
